Woman, lover arrested for husband’s murder in Sangareddy

Police in Sangareddy district uncovered an alleged murder conspiracy involving a woman and her lover after investigating a missing person complaint. The accused allegedly killed the woman’s husband, buried the body in a farm field and attempted to mislead investigators.

Sangareddy: An alleged extramarital affair led to the murder of yet another man in Sangareddy district. In a shocking incident, the woman, who killed her husband with the support of her lover in Gangapur village, registered a complaint at Narayankhed police station hours after the murder.

However, during the investigations, police found that the woman, Kalpana, who was in a relationship with Ghaini Pandari alias Chintu, killed her husband, Muthyam Reddy, on May 16. Later, Kalpana and Chintu buried him in an agricultural field at Yelgoi village in Manoor mandal.


Kalpana had later registered a missing persons complaint at the police station on May 17. Kalpana and Muthyam Reddy, who were married in 2012, had two daughters, both aged below 10 years. While Kalpana worked as a nurse in a private hospital in Narayankhed, Muthyam Reddy used to work as a borewell mechanic in the village.

Chintu, who was working as an outsourcing mechanic in TGRTC, befriended Kalpana. Muthyam Reddy reportedly warned Kalpana over her relationship. Since he had been getting in the way of their relationship, Kalpana and Chintu decided to eliminate him. The police were on the job to exhume the body from burial now. Further details are awaited.
